West Kowloon Cultural District

Hong Kong, China

The West Kowloon Cultural District will see the creation of a new cultural district in Hong Kong. It will include several buildings dedicated to the Performing Arts such as the Music Centre (2,000-seat symphony concert hall, 600-seat chamber hall and orchestra rehearsal hall), the Grand Theatre (2,000-seat opera house, 400-seat chamber opera house), the Music Theatre (2,000-seat auditorium for amplified events) and the Medium Theatre (600-seat theatre and 150-seat theatre).

Sébastien Jouan’s role was to establish the acoustic program as well as a preliminary acoustic design service with the establishment of the dimensions and volumes required for each room and the logistics associated with these rooms, as well as advice on the constructions required for acoustic insulation between each room. All this information was provided in order to establish the footprint of each building.

Architects: Leigh and Orange

Theatre and Acoustic Design: Theatre Projects USA

Role of Sébastien Jouan: Technical Director and Acoustician of the Project under contract Theatre Projects
